MCC-Nepal Background & Project Description

In September 2017, the U.S. Government’s Millennium Challenge Corporation (MCC) signed a $500 million compact
agreement with the Government of Nepal. The Compact aims to increase the availability and reliability of electricity,
maintain road quality, and facilitate power trade between Nepal and India helping to spur investments, and accelerate
economic growth. The compact agreement is valid for a period of five years, and is currently in the implementation stage.

Pursuant to the aforementioned agreement, the entity charged with implementing the project has been established as the
Millennium Challenge Account Nepal (MCA-Nepal) entity. This position will assume a critical role in the success of MCANepal.

MCC-Nepal Position Objective for Procurement & Contracting Specialist

The Procurement & Contracting (PC) Specialist, under the supervision of Manager-Program Procurement, is responsible
for overseeing the delivery and implementation of procurement and contract administration-related supports that include
resource acquisition, resource levelling, contract tracking, etc.

The PC shall ensure that contract administration andprocurement activities are conducted in compliance with the principles, rules and procedures set out in the AccountableEntity MCC Procurement Policy and Guidelines (PPG), Contract Administration Manual, Procurement Handbook,Procurement Operations Manual, Nepal Compact Agreement, and any Supplemental Agreements with respect to Compact
funded activities.
